The Cleaning Engine

A 6-enzyme blend. More than any natural detergent.

Same scent you choose, same powerhouse formula underneath. Six enzyme classes — each engineered for a specific category of stain.

6
Targeted Enzymes · Active in Every Wash
1

Protease

Blood · Sweat · Grass · Dairy

Breaks down protein-based stains at the molecular level — the body soils ordinary detergent leaves on collars and sheets.

2

Amylase

Starch · Food Residue · Baby Formula

Cuts starch into water-soluble fragments that rinse away — stopping invisible buildup that traps other residue over time.

3

Lipase

Cooking Oils · Butter · Grease

Breaks lipid bonds so fats rinse cleanly instead of building up wash after wash — the leading cause of dingy-looking clothes.

4

Mannanase

Guar Gum · Thickeners · Sauces

Targets the gums and thickeners in processed foods — the sticky residues that make fabric feel stiff and look dull.

5

Pectate-Lyase RARE

Fruit · Tomato · Berry · Wine

Breaks down pectin-based stains — fruit, tomato, berry, wine, baby food. Particularly effective in cold water, where most enzymes underperform.

6

Cellulase RARE

Plant Fiber · Pilling · Brightness

Targets plant fiber and vegetable residue while smoothing pilling and restoring brightness — without optical brighteners or synthetic additives.

Does Orange Blossom work in hard water?+
Yes. We updated the formula in March 2026 with sodium gluconate, a natural hard-water chelator from glucose fermentation. It binds calcium and magnesium ions before they leave mineral residue on fabric. Standard dosing works in hard water — no need to use more detergent.
